About Simon Stone
Simon Stone is a scholar working on Oral Surgery, Periodontics, Orthodontics, Emergency Medicine and General Dentistry, having authored 35 papers that have together received 509 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Endodontics and Root Canal Treatments (6 papers), Dental Anxiety and Anesthesia Techniques (5 papers), Dental Health and Care Utilization (5 papers), Dental Radiography and Imaging (4 papers), Emergency and Acute Care Studies (3 papers), Dental Research and COVID-19 (2 papers), Dental Erosion and Treatment (2 papers) and Dental materials and restorations (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in General Dentistry (66 citations), Orthodontics (127 citations), Periodontics (106 citations), Oral Surgery (161 citations) and Complementary and Manual Therapy (17 citations). Simon Stone has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Ireland. Frequent co-authors include Justin Durham, David Edwards, Paula Waterhouse, Matthew J. German, Rawan N. AlKahtani, Charlotte C. Currie, P. A. Heasman, Giles McCracken, Konrad Staines and Henry F. Duncan. Their work appears in journals such as BDJ, International Endodontic Journal, Journal of Dental Research, Journal of Oral Rehabilitation and Journal of Dentistry.
